Nigeria Product Scams: How to Spot copyright and Save Your Money
Online shopping from Nigeria can be a fantastic way to find unique items and save money. But unfortunately, there are also scammers who try to rip you off by selling fake goods. Don't let those fraudsters ruin your shopping experience!
Here are some tips on how to spot fake products and keep your money:
- Always check the seller's reviews. A trusted seller will have a high number of reviews.
- Be wary of prices that are significantly lower than usual. If it sounds like a steal, it probably is
- Examine carefully the product photos. Are they well-lit? Do they show every side of the product? If the images are blurry, pixelated, or missing details, it could be a red flag
- Reach out to the seller if you have any concerns. A real seller will be happy to help
By following these tips, you can avoid the possibility of falling victim to a Nigeria product scam and keep your hard-earned cash safe.
